Suwel is the trade name for the generic medicine Sucralfate, an antiulcer drug that belongs to the class of Gastrointestinal Agents known for their cytoprotective effect. This medication provides a local, physical defense mechanism primarily aimed at safeguarding the lining of the digestive tract. Its general purpose is to create optimal conditions for the healing of damaged or inflamed mucosal tissue.


What Type of Medicine is Suwel (Sucralfate)?

Sucralfate is classified as a cytoprotective agent, meaning its principal function is to provide physical protection to the body's cells and tissues, particularly those in the gastrointestinal system. As such, the drug forms a protective complex to prevent further damage to the mucosal layer.

Unlike pharmaceuticals such as H2-receptor antagonists or Proton Pump Inhibitors (PPIs), which reduce the volume or concentration of stomach acid, Sucralfate functions primarily through topical action at the site of injury. This strategy places it in a distinct therapeutic category, as its benefit is derived from localized site-specific binding rather than through systemic pharmacological effects. Sucralfate is consistently positioned as a prescription-only medication intended for adult patients.

Sucralfate: Composition and Available Forms

The active ingredient in Suwel is Sucralfate, a synthetic compound that is chemically defined as a sulfated disaccharide complexed with aluminum hydroxide, resulting in a complex aluminum salt. Sucralfate is negligibly absorbed systemically, which confirms its localized gastrointestinal action.

Sucralfate is administered via the oral route and is generally available as a tablet and an oral suspension (liquid form). This range allows flexibility for patients, particularly those who may have difficulty swallowing pills. The provision of an aqueous vehicle in the suspension form is key, as it can allow for broader, more uniform distribution of the cytoprotective agent over the irritated or damaged surface of the digestive tract.

What is the General Purpose of Sucralfate?

The general purpose of Sucralfate is to promote the healing of compromised mucosal tissue by establishing an effective physical shield against digestive irritants. When swallowed, this agent preferentially adheres to the base of ulcers and eroded areas, creating a robust, sticky polymer barrier. This defense mechanism shields the injured tissue from corrosive substances present in the stomach, including hydrochloric acid, the digestive enzyme pepsin, and refluxed bile salts. By providing this sustained protection, Sucralfate creates a localized environment that facilitates the body's natural restorative processes and generally helps to relieve discomfort.

What side effects are possible with Suwel?

Possible Side Effects and Safety Information

The safety profile of Suwel (sucralfate) is characterized by adverse reactions that are predominantly localized to the gastrointestinal system, consistent with the drug's minimal systemic absorption. The official regulatory documents classify these effects by frequency and the body system affected.


Frequency and System-Organ Classes

The most frequently reported adverse reaction is constipation, which is classified as common in official prescribing information. Other effects are generally classified as uncommon, meaning they occur in less than 1% of patients in clinical trials. These uncommon reactions are officially listed across several body systems:

  • Gastrointestinal Disorders: Dry mouth, indigestion, nausea, vomiting, gastric discomfort.
  • Nervous System Disorders: Headache, dizziness, insomnia, sleepiness.
  • Dermatological Disorders: Pruritus (itching), rash.

Serious Adverse Reactions and Safety Considerations

Official labeling documents address rare, but clinically significant, safety risks:

  • Aluminum Toxicity: Sucralfate contains aluminum, and its use requires caution in patients with chronic renal failure or those receiving dialysis. These individuals have an increased risk of aluminum accumulation and subsequent toxicity (e.g., osteomalacia or encephalopathy) due to impaired excretion.
  • Bezoar Formation: Cases of bezoar (a mass of undigested material) have been reported, primarily in patients with impaired gastrointestinal motility or other pre-existing conditions.
  • Hypersensitivity: Rare but serious adverse reactions, including angioedema and urticaria, are documented as possible hypersensitivity events. The medication is formally contraindicated in patients with known hypersensitivity to sucralfate or any of its components.

Overdose and Emergency Response

Overdose and When to Seek Help

The official regulatory profile for Suwel (sucralfate) indicates that the risk associated with acute oral overdosage is minimal. This classification is due to the drug’s characteristic of being only negligibly absorbed from the gastrointestinal tract into the systemic circulation.

Overdose experience in humans is limited, and official labeling states that no specific treatment recommendations can be given.

Overdose Presentation Emergency Actions Mandated
Asymptomatic (most patients in rare reports). Immediately contact a poison control center or a doctor for guidance.
Minor gastrointestinal symptoms: dyspepsia, abdominal pain, nausea, or vomiting. Immediately call emergency services if the affected person has collapsed, had a seizure, has trouble breathing, or cannot be awakened.

A specific regulatory note addresses patients with chronic renal failure or those receiving dialysis. These individuals have impaired excretion of the small amounts of aluminum absorbed from sucralfate. The official prescribing information documents that prolonged use may lead to aluminum accumulation and toxicity (such as encephalopathy) in these specific populations.

Therapeutic Uses of Suwel

What Suwel Treats: Main Uses and Benefits

Suwel (sucralfate, or its combination with oxetacaine in some formulations) is primarily prescribed as a supportive measure in the management of gastrointestinal conditions. Its main purpose is to facilitate the natural healing of certain sores or lesions within the digestive tract.


Quick Facts

  • Addresses: Duodenal ulcers (in the small intestine).
  • Supports: Healing of peptic and stomach ulcers.
  • Helps manage: Irritation or damage to the stomach and intestinal lining.

Suwel is indicated for the treatment of duodenal ulcers and is a management option for stomach ulcers (gastric ulcers). It is intended to help protect the affected lining of the digestive tract from injury by gastric acid and digestive enzymes, thereby supporting the healing process of the ulcerated tissue. In its combination forms, it may also be used to help alleviate discomfort associated with acidity, heartburn, and inflammation of the stomach (gastritis).

This medication is part of a standard therapeutic plan and may be prescribed to patients requiring long-term protection of the stomach lining, such as those using certain nonsteroidal anti-inflammatory drugs (NSAIDs).

Eligibility and Restrictions for Use

Who Can and Cannot Use Suwel? — Official Regulatory Information

The eligibility for Suwel (Sucralfate) is defined by official regulatory documents, primarily focusing on age, organ function, and pre-existing conditions.


Populations for Whom Use is Restricted or Prohibited

Category Regulatory Status Constraint Details
Absolute Contraindication Contraindicated Patients with known hypersensitivity to Sucralfate or its excipients.
Age Groups Not Established/Caution Safety and effectiveness in pediatric patients have not been established. Geriatric patients require caution in dose selection due to potential decreased renal function.
Organ Function Use with Caution Patients with chronic renal failure or on dialysis must use the medication with caution due to the risk of aluminum accumulation.
Physiological States Conditional Use Use during pregnancy and lactation is only recommended if clearly needed, and requires caution.
Comorbidities Restricted Use Use is restricted in patients with conditions predisposing to bezoar formation (e.g., delayed gastric emptying) or those receiving enteral tube feedings.

Official Eligibility Profile

Official labeling classifies the eligible population as primarily adult patients requiring treatment for duodenal ulcers. The most significant restrictions involve the renal function status and conditions that may impair gastrointestinal transit. Any patient with impaired swallowing or an altered gag reflex must also use the medication with caution.

What should I know about interactions with other medicines?

Interactions with other medicines and products

Suwel (sucralfate) has an official interaction profile defined by two principal mechanisms: non-systemic pharmacokinetic binding and additive aluminum exposure. These interactions result in specific constraints detailed in regulatory labeling.


Official Interaction Types

Interaction Domain Mechanism and Outcome
Reduced Bioavailability Sucralfate reduces the extent of absorption of several co-administered oral medications by physical binding in the gastrointestinal tract.
Aluminum Accumulation Co-administration with aluminum-containing products may increase the total body burden of aluminum, particularly in susceptible populations.

Constraints and Requirements

The non-systemic binding interaction mandates a timing separation requirement. To eliminate the reduced absorption of affected oral medicines, such as Digoxin, Phenytoin, or Ciprofloxacin, they must be administered two hours before sucralfate. This specific spacing is officially documented to resolve the interference.

The label also identifies an additive pharmacodynamic constraint: patients with Chronic Renal Failure and Dialysis are explicitly noted to be at risk of aluminum accumulation and toxicity due to impaired excretion. Additionally, antacids should be taken at least 30 minutes before or after sucralfate.

Mechanism of Action

How Suwel Works: Mechanism of Action

The mechanism of action for Suwel (Sucralfate) is entirely localized and multifaceted, focusing on the physical and biological protection of the gastrointestinal lining at the site of damage. Its activity is non-systemic, operating directly at the tissue level rather than through bloodstream absorption or systemic receptor modulation.


️ Acid-Activated Physical Adherence and Shielding

The drug's primary action is initiated by the gastric acid environment ( pH < 4 ), which activates the sucralfate molecule. It then rapidly forms a dense, polyanionic polymer that preferentially and powerfully binds to the positively charged proteins (like fibrinogen and albumin) exposed at the base of ulcers or erosions. This creates a physical barrier or coating over exposed tissue proteins. This process results in the physical isolation of exposed proteins from luminal contents, contributing to the stabilization of the local tissue structure.


️ Dual Modulation of Irritants and Defense Factors

The polymer layer serves a dual role: it inhibits the destructive activity of the enzyme Pepsin A and adsorbs corrosive bile salts , reducing local chemical irritation . Simultaneously, the physical barrier locally concentrates the body’s natural trophic peptides, such as EGF and FGF-2, protecting them from degradation. This environment indirectly stimulates the release of prostaglandins, which modulates local microcirculation and augments the secretion of mucus and bicarbonate . These combined actions establish conditions favorable for epithelial restitution and tissue repair processes.

How should Suwel be stored and disposed of?

How to Store and Dispose of Suwel? (Sucralfate)

Official regulatory documents define strict conditions for storing and disposing of Suwel (Sucralfate) to ensure stability and safety.


Storage Requirements

  • Temperature and Environment: The medicine must be kept at controlled room temperature, specifically between 20 C and 25 C (68 F and 77 F). Store it away from excess heat and moisture.
  • Handling: The oral suspension form must not be frozen. Keep the product in its original container and ensure it is tightly closed.
  • Child Safety: It is mandatory to keep the medicine out of the sight and reach of children and to lock safety caps to prevent accidental ingestion.

Disposal Instructions

Discard any expired or unused Suwel according to official guidance. The product should preferably be disposed of through a drug take-back program. If this is not available, the medication is generally mixed with an unappealing substance, sealed in a bag, and then placed in the household trash. The product is not recommended for disposal by flushing.
